Jake Evans / ABC:
Meta admits to scraping every Australian adult Facebook user's public data to train AI, with no opt-out option as it is not required to do so under privacy law  —  In short:  —  Facebook is scraping the public data of all Australian adults on the platform, it has acknowledged in an inquiry.

Paul Sawers / TechCrunch:
MariaDB, which went public via SPAC in December 2022, says it's been acquired by PE firm K1 and names a new CEO, after filing to delist its shares from the NYSE  —  MariaDB's short-lived tenure as a public company is all but over, as the struggling database business is now fully under the auspices of K1 Investment Management.

Brianna Sacks / Washington Post:
An analysis finds 40+ examples of Facebook removing emergency-related posts during 20+ US wildfires since June 2024; Meta says it is “investigating this issue”  —  The Post has collected more than 40 examples of Facebook removing emergency-related posts during at least 20 wildfires since June.
